Facts to Consider About the
Location
You should carefully choose an indoor location for the new
water heater, because the placement is a very important consid-
eration for the safety of the occupants in the building and for
the most economical use of the appliance. This water heater is
not for use in mobile homes or outdoor installation.
Whether replacing an old water heater or putting the water
heater in a new location, the following critical points must be
observed.
The location selected should be indoors as close as practical
to the gas vent or chimney to which the water heater vent is
going to be connected, and as centralized with the water pip-
ing system as possible. The water heater, as all water heaters,
will eventually leak. Do not install without adequate
drainage provisions where water flow will cause damage.

AWARNING
INSTALLATIONS IN AREAS WHERE FLAMMABLE LIQUIDS
(VAPORS) ARE LIKELY TO BE PRESENT OR STORED
(GARAGES, STORAGE, AND UTILITY AREAS, ETC):
Flammable liquids (such as gasoline, solvents,propane (LP) or
butane, etc.), all of which emit flammable vapors, may be
improperly stored or used in suchareas. The gaswater heater
pilot light or main burner can ignite suchvapors.The resulting
flashbackand fire cancausedeath or serious burns to anyone in
the area, aswell asproperty damage.
If installationin suchareas isyour only option, then the installa.
tion must be accomplished in a way that the pilot flame and
main burner flame are elevated from the floor at least 18 inches.
While this may reduce the chancesof flammable vapors from
floor spillbeing ignited,gasolineandother flammable substance!
shouldnever be stored or used in the same room or area con.
raining a gaswater heater or other open flame or spark produc-
ingappliance.
NOTE: Flammable vapors may be drawn by air currents from
other areasof the structure to the appliance.
AWARNING
Propellants of aerosol spraysand volatile compounds, (clean-
ers, chlorine basedchemicals, refrigerants, etc.) in addition to
being highlyflammable in many cases,will also change to cor-
rosive hydrochloric acid when exposed to the combustion :
products of the water heater. The results can be hazardous,
and also cause product failure.
The location selection must provide adequate clearances for ser-
vicing and proper operation o_'the water heater.
AWARNING
This water heater must not be installeddirectly on carpeting.
Carpeting must be protected by a metal or wood panel
beneath the appliance extending beyond the full width and
depth of the appliance by at least 3 inches (76.2mm) in any
direction, or if the appliance is installed in an alcove or closet,
the entire floor must be covered by the panel. Failure to heed
this warning may result inafire hazard.
AWARNING
Minimum clearances between the water heater and com-
bustible construction are I" at the sides and rear, 4" at the
front, and 6" from the vent pipe. Clearance from the top of the
jacket is 18"on most models.Note that a lesserdimension may
be allowed on some models. Refer to the label on the water
heater adjacent to the gascontrol valvefor all clearances.

AWARNING
A gaswater heater cannot operate properly without the cor-
rect amount of air for combustion. Do not install in a confined
area sucha closet,unlessyou provideair asshownin the "Facts
to Consider about the Location" section. Never obstruct the
flow ofventilation air. Ifyou have any doubts or questionsat all,
callyour gascompany. Failureto provide the proper amount of
combustion air can result in a fire or explosion and can cause
DEATH, SERIOUS BODILY INJUR_,OR PROPERTY DAMAGE.
AWARNING
If this water heater will be usedin beauty shops,barber shops,
cleaning establishments, or self-service laundries with dry
cleaning equipment, it is imperative that the water heater or
water heaters be installed so that combustion and ventilation
air be taken from outside these areas. Refer to the "Facts to
Consider About the Location" section of this manual and also
the latest edition of the National FuelGas Code, ANSI Z223.1,
also referred to as NFPA 54 for specificsprovided concerning
air required.
